Vans and Nintendo Collaboration

Shoe brand Vans Classics and game console maker Nintendo have released a joint collection of shoes and accessories. The collection includes sneakers, backpacks, T-shirts, socks and caps with characters from computer games NES (Nintendo Entertainment System), the first console of the company: Super Mario Bros., Duck Hunt, Donkey Kong and Legend of Zelda.

In the line of shoes there are four options for Authentic sneakers with prints based on games, as well as Vans Slip-On slip-ons. The prints of the Sk8-Hi and Old Skool slip-on models are based on the Legend of Zelda game. On the soles of shoes and accessories, designers have placed the slogan Game Over! The children's collection includes Sk8-Hi Zip, Classic Slip-on and Authentic models with Mario Kart and Super Mario prints.

Vans is an American company headquartered in Cypress, California. Since the mid-1960s, it has been producing shoes, clothes and accessories for sports. This brand is very popular among skateboarders and representatives of the counterculture.

Nintendo Co., Ltd. Is a Japanese manufacturer of hardware and software for the Wii U and Wii home consoles, portable systems of the Nintendo 3DS line and Nintendo DS. The company is headquartered in Kyoto (Japan).
